The life of a red bulb used in a traffic signal can be modeled using an exponential distribution with an average life of 24 months. the maintenance worker inspects the signal every year.

• what is probability that the red bulb will need to be replaced at the first inspection?
• if the bulb is in good condition at the end of 18 months, what is the probability that the bulb will be in good condition at the end of 24 months? hint: use p(a | b) = p(a∩b) p(b)
• if the signal has six red bulbs, what is the probability that atleast one of them needs replacement at the first inspection? assume distribution of lifetime of each bulb is independent.
